### Runbook: Account Recovery — Payroll Export Change

Security reviewer context: Saltmere's payroll export moved from fixed-width to signed archive format last quarter. If the export service account locks during the cutover, do not recreate it; downstream signatures would break. Instead, restore the account from the sealed credential bundle, verify the archive signing chain, and re-enable exports. Unsealing the bundle requires the recovery passphrase below.

vault phrase of bagaf-kajeg = jorath-feniel-briir-siliel-ralix

Hi Tomas — welcome to the Medreach on-call rotation. Quick note on the clinic appointment reminder job: it runs hourly, batches by clinic timezone, and silently skips patients with unverified contact preferences. If the batch count drops to zero, check the preference sync first, not the scheduler. The retry queue drains itself; don't manually flush it. Since you're reviewing the reminder code this week, the architecture notes and alert thresholds are on the internal page.

runbook for badug-kadup: https://confluence.zemvarlabs.internal/projects/browse/display/projects/bd1b

Before migrating the report export service, confirm that all scheduled exports use canonical zone identifiers rather than fixed offsets. Legacy Fernwheel jobs stored offsets captured at creation time, which produces incorrect timestamps after daylight transitions. The migration script rewrites these, but you must verify the defaults first — a mismatch here will silently shift every row in nightly reports. If paged during the cutover, compare the running service against the expected settings listed below.

service settings:
PRAIX_LOG_LEVEL=error
PRAIX_METRICS_HOST=metrics.praix.qorvelcorp.corp
PRAIX_POOL_SIZE=16